Stuck deciding between the mountains, the coast and the countryside? All three are easily accessed from Ael y Garnedd, a family-run touring park in Star, Anglesey. How so? Well, this site has a splendid selection of well-maintained, level pitches in pleasant grounds just off the A55, easily accessible from the Britannia Bridge and close to the Anglesey coastline. The pitches have the added bonus of spectacular views over the mountains of Snowdonia National Park (which is from 20 minutes’ drive away, by the way). Whether it's mountaineering in Snowdonia, rib rides and exploring the castle in Beaumaris (20 minutes), or lunch in Caernarfon (20 minutes), the site's central location is bound to come very much in handy. That’s what makes this place such a great base for family and dog-friendly holidays spent both on the island and mainland. Sandy beaches are close by too, and you'll be less than 30 minutes from the offerings at Benllech, Aberffraw, Rhosneigr and Ynys Llanddwyn, a haven for ramblers, rockpoolers and cyclists. With amenities like grey-waste disposal, toilets and showers all provided, as well as a laundry room, life on site is comfortable, and if you do need to venture out it won't take you long to find what you're looking for. The nearest pub is five minutes' drive, while Menai Bridge (10 minutes) has a large supermarket and an array of shops and restaurants.

Local attractions

When you want to stay pretty local, make Menai Suspension Bridge (five minutes' drive) your first stop. The huge suspension bridge between Anglesey and mainland Wales is a sight to behold. Plas Cadnant Hidden Gardens (10 minutes) is rather interesting too, as a historic estate with peaceful gardens and tea rooms. Beaumaris (20 minutes) next? This stop is by the seaside, hence the gorgeous promenade, and the castle is also worth a visit. Caernarfon Castle (20 minutes) has a big ‘wow’ factor too – the huge palace-style fortress sits along the river Seiont and looks very grand. In Conwy (30 minutes), there’s another castle, as well as the harbour where boat tours take off across the coast. For those of you interested in getting to know legends and history around St David, visit the island of Ynys Llanddwyn (30 minutes). The scenery is just as great at Great Orme (45 minutes), a chunk of limestone land that juts out into the sea and has been named the ‘sea monster’ by the Vikings. Time for some adrenaline instead? Zip World Fforest (40 minutes) has a forest rollercoaster and zipwires or swings over the treetops.
